lvr2::LBKdTree Member List

This is the complete list of members for lvr2::LBKdTree, including all inherited members.

fillCriticalIndices(const LBPointArray< float > &V, LBPointArray< unsigned int > &sorted_indices, unsigned int current_dim, float split_value, unsigned int split_index, std::list< unsigned int > &critical_indices_left, std::list< unsigned int > &critical_indices_right)lvr2::LBKdTreeprivatestatic
fillCriticalIndicesSet(const LBPointArray< float > &V, LBPointArray< unsigned int > &sorted_indices, unsigned int current_dim, float split_value, unsigned int split_index, std::unordered_set< unsigned int > &critical_indices_left, std::unordered_set< unsigned int > &critical_indices_right)lvr2::LBKdTreeprivatestatic
generateKdTree(LBPointArray< float > &vertices)lvr2::LBKdTree
generateKdTreeArray(LBPointArray< float > &V, LBPointArray< unsigned int > *sorted_indices, int max_dim)lvr2::LBKdTreeprivate
generateKdTreeRecursive(int id, LBPointArray< float > &V, LBPointArray< unsigned int > *sorted_indices, int current_dim, int max_dim, LBPointArray< float > *values, LBPointArray< unsigned char > *splits, int size, int max_tree_depth, int position, int current_depth)lvr2::LBKdTreeprivatestatic
getKdTreeSplits()lvr2::LBKdTree
getKdTreeValues()lvr2::LBKdTree
LBKdTree(LBPointArray< float > &vertices, int num_threads=8)lvr2::LBKdTree
m_splitslvr2::LBKdTreeprivate
m_valueslvr2::LBKdTreeprivate
poollvr2::LBKdTreeprivatestatic
st_depth_threadslvr2::LBKdTreeprivatestatic
st_num_threadslvr2::LBKdTreeprivatestatic
test(int id, LBPointArray< float > *sorted_indices)lvr2::LBKdTreeprivatestatic
~LBKdTree()lvr2::LBKdTree


lvr2
Author(s): Thomas Wiemann , Sebastian Pütz , Alexander Mock , Lars Kiesow , Lukas Kalbertodt , Tristan Igelbrink , Johan M. von Behren , Dominik Feldschnieders , Alexander Löhr
autogenerated on Wed Mar 2 2022 00:37:27